Scheduled refresh started failing, keeps forgetting credentials

Hi, hoping you can help me as I have a number of dashboards depending on this refresh.

 

Scheduled refresh has been working perfect since I set it up a month ago, and all of the sudden it's starting to fail saying it can refresh due to a credential authentication issue.

 

When I edit credentials, authentication is set to Anonymous. I change it back to OAuth2, enter my credentials and it accepts it. When I go back to check, it's set to Anonymous again.

 

It's really frustrating. It's a web connection to a SP excel file, set up via PBI Desktop.

After you edit the credential to the correct one, can you refresh the dataset on demand successfully? Based on my test, although when I go back to check the authentication, it is set to Anonymous again instead of OAuth2, but I can refresh the dataset properly.
